Your new role:
The Clinical Nurse (CN) provides advanced clinical knowledge, expert planning, and coordination to manage clients with complex care needs within a specialized addiction service.
- Lead clinical care: Coordinate and deliver expert specialist nursing care for clients experiencing substance use disorders.
- Guide the team: Provide direct operational leadership, mentorship, and shift coordination in support of the Nurse Unit Manager.
- Uphold safety standards: Apply clinical governance and quality frameworks through audits, incident reporting, and risk mitigation.

Metro South Addiction and Mental Health Services:
Metro South Addiction and Mental Health Services provide inpatient, hospital-based and community mental health and community alcohol and drug services for all age groups across a number of campuses.
We embrace a forward looking, progressive approach and work collaboratively with all stakeholders in order to achieve expected outcomes. A clear and strong consumer and carer focus is promoted with our vision being to provide our community excellence in consumer centred, integrated care across the continuum of addiction (alcohol and drug) and mental health services.

We are Metro South Health:
We are the major public healthcare provider for Brisbane's south side, Logan, Redlands, and the Scenic Rim operating five major hospitals and a range of community, specialty, and state-wide healthcare services.
